Abstract

Die Erfindung betrifft eine Vorrichtung (2) zum Widerstandsschweissen eines Werkstücks (40, 40'), umfas- send wenigstens eine Schweisselektrode (10a, 10a'; 10b, 10b') mit einem Elektrodenkörper (11a, 11b). Weiter sind Messmittel zur Erfassung der Temperatur der wenigstens einen Schweisselektrode (10a, 10a'; 10b, 10b') bzw. des Werkstücks (40, 40') durch Messung elektro- magnetischer Strahlung, vorzugsweise Infrarotstrahlung, vorgesehen. Die Messmittel umfassen wenigstens eine Aufnahmeeinheit zur Aufnahme der Strahlung sowie eine Wandlereinheit zur Erzeugung eines Signals, das wenigstens von einem Parameter der von der Aufnahmeeinheit aufgenommenen Strahlung abhängt. Erfindungsgemäss ist die wenigstens eine Aufnahmeeinheit der Messmittel räumlich im Bereich der wenigstens einen Schweisselektrode (10a, 10a'; 10b, 10b') angeordnet. Die Erfindung bezieht sich darüber hinaus auf eine besonders vorteilhaft gestaltete Schweisselektrode.
